IMAX theaters use nonstandard aspect ratios: 1:90:1 for digital presentations and 1:43:1 for film. Those ratios make the image proportionally taller and more square than normal cinema screens, expanding past the viewer's peripheral vision. For a 70mm film, an IMAX theater is about 59 feet tall and 79 feet wide. The result is not just a larger version of the same image, but a different image, particularly when films are shot with IMAX cameras that capture more information.
The larger canvas does not come automatically. 'We have to plan very carefully because by shooting an IMAX film, you capture a lot of information,' Nolan told the Associated Press, as quoted by Engadget. 'Your movie is going to translate very well to all the formats because you're getting the ultimate amount of visual information.' He added that because theater screens have different shapes, directors must frame imagery so it performs in a variety of venues. That work continues for digital films, where filmmakers adapt lenses, lighting and sound to satisfy IMAX and non-IMAX releases. Films labeled 'Filmed for IMAX' involve direct collaboration with the exhibitor, supported by remastering software that cleans and enhances footage for large presentation.
Projection systems also differ. The common IMAX Digital setups, often retrofitted in Cinemark, AMC, Regal and Dolby locations, use dual xenon lamps and achieve 1:90:1 aspect ratios but lack the resolution gains of laser systems. IMAX's Laser GT projectors use two 4K lasers for floor-to-ceiling ratios, better clarity and richer colors. A single-laser IMAX system supports the 1:90:1 ratio but improves contrast and brightness compared with xenon. For those who consider film the most premium route, 70mm has a long cinematic history, including Stanley Kubrick's '2001: A Space Odyssey.' IMAX's contribution to 70mm is horizontal running and a fifteen-perforation layout, which dramatically enlarges the area of each frame. The reels for 'The Odyssey' run more than ten miles long, weigh about 500 pounds and move through the projector at hundreds of miles per hour.
